Most salesmen will have monthly goals or quotas they need to meet. Use this system to your advantage by shopping at the end of the month. Salespeople who have a quota will be more willing to negotiate in order to seal the deal.This gives you a bit more leverage in your price negotiations.

Do not talk about your trade-in. Wait to mention a trade-in vehicle until after you have negotiated the new car.

Research properly when you want to buy a car purchase. There are many websites online sources that will give you of what your car is worth. You could use NADA or Kelly Blue Book to figure out a car is. If the car is priced higher than these sources have them priced, head someplace else.
